LAMP環境 php的webservice介面

2021-06-22 16:46:13 字數 1414 閱讀 1020

1. 建立

lamp

下php

的webservice介面

1.1 

nusoap- 0.9.5.zip

,解壓縮後有兩個資料夾:

lib,

samples

1.2 

在linux

環境下,

將lib

資料夾拷到/var/www/html資料夾中

1.3 

在html資料夾下面建立

server.php

,提供了2個

webservice

介面,**如下:

1.4在nusoap

資料夾下面建立

test.php

,測試提供的

webservice

介面,**如下:

<?php

require_once("lib/nusoap.php");

$client = newnusoap_client("");

$str=$client->call('hello');

echo $str;

echo "

";$a=1;

$b=3;

$params2 = array('a'=>$a,'b'=>$b);

$added = $client->call('add', $params2);

echo $a."+".$b."=".$added;

?>

1.5在位址列輸入

,頁面顯示結果如下:

hello world!

1+3=4

2. android

應用程式呼叫

php的

webservice介面

2.1在androidsdk中並沒有提供呼叫webservice的庫,因此,需要使用第三方的sdk來呼叫webservice。這裡用的是ksoap2。

2.2 匯入jar包,新建工程,**如下:

public

voidshowresult(intx,inty)

catch(exception e)  

}

php 搭建LAMP環境

先說明本操作是在centos系統上實現的,且要切換到root使用者 su root 下操作 開啟終端,輸入命令 如不需要postgresql資料庫,可以把postpresql相關命令刪除 php pgsql一樣 ps php devel表示php開發包 1 安裝要等待1,2分鐘,安裝完成後,啟動ap...

PHP 環境 Lamp環境搭建 phpStudy

phpstudy for linux 支援apache nginx tengine lighttpd,支援php5.2 5.3 5.4 5.5切換 已經在centos 6.5,debian 7.4.ubuntu 13.10測試成功。完整版 安裝 wget c chmod x phpstudy.bin...

LAMP環境搭建 php環境搭建

yum groupinstall development tools y yum groupinstall desktop platform development y yum install cmake pcre devel ncurses devel openssl devel libcurl ...